Abstract
Transport coefficeints, in particular the shear viscosity to entropy density ratio is studied in systems where the small-width quasiparticle assumption is not valid. It is found that has no unversal lower bound, the minimal value depends on the system and the temperature, and can be even zero. We construct models where the conjectured bound is violated.
